Electron spin resonance studies of ion association. Part 8.—Effects of ion-pairing on 14N hyperfine splittings in p-substituted nitrobenzene anions
Abstract
The nitro group 14N hyperfine splittings have been measured for the radical anions of nitro-benzene, p-nitrotoluene, p-nitroanisole, p-nitrobenzaldehyde and p-nitrobenzonitrile prepared by reduction with lithium, sodium, potassium or caesium in dimethoxyethane, tetrahydrofuran or methyltetrahydrofuran. The values observed form a pattern which can be rationalised quantitatively using a simple inductive model to describe the anion–cation interaction.
